CASE70571: Horary consultation concerning Old Mr John Bouth (PERSON44568)

Question asked by the patient on 23 April 1630 at 09:52

RN old Mr \Iohn/ Bouth 60 y. Ap. 23. {illeg}||. h. 9. 52. ant m 1630 hard of hearing: a leane face & body & tall no wife 9 y |of Dūnā in Sr George Bouths house|

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 194, p. 286 (bottom left part of page)

CASE12083: Horary consultation concerning William Loveles (PERSON13804)

Question asked by the patient on 15 March 1599 at 09:00

RN Williā Lovely of Newport 60. greeped & tormented at the harte ready to make him selfe away & of his brest: the 15 of Martij die . h. 9 metuit venefic: 1599 hed & face swelleth.

[Astrological Chart]

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 228, f. 103r (bottom left part of page)
